What is the lug width of the Breitling Chronomat 40 GMT A32398B41C1A1?
The lug width of the Breitling Chronomat 40 GMT A32398B41C1A1 is 20mm. This measurement is taken between the spring bars inside the case lugs and is the critical parameter for selecting a compatible strap.

How do I change the strap on the Breitling Chronomat 40 GMT?
To replace the strap, remove the spring bars from the lugs using a fine-tipped springbar tool. The original Breitling spring bars are standard diameter and can be reused with quality aftermarket straps. It is advisable to work on a soft surface to avoid scratching the case or bezel.

How long does a leather strap last on a Breitling Chronomat 40 GMT?
Longevity depends on the material and care routine. A high-quality vegetable-tanned alligator strap, conditioned every 3–4 months and kept away from excessive moisture, can last over five years while retaining structural integrity and patina. Calf leather typically lasts 2–3 years with daily wear. Frequent exposure to water or perspiration significantly reduces the lifespan of any leather strap.
